Four women among seven killed in accident



By Our Correspondent


MINGORA, May 23: Seven members of a family were killed and three others were injured when a truck going to Gujjar Gabral village from Mardan fell into the River Swat near Kalam due to brake failure. Four of the passengers who died were women.

Those killed were identified as Ibrahim, Abdul Wahab, Sakeena, Kausar Bibi, Bakht Zaroon, Maimoona and Javeria. Those injured were identified as Abdul Mannan, Motabar and Niaz.

Five other people were killed in three other incidents. A Mankial-bound pick-up plunged into the river in Cham Garhi near Behrain, killing three people.

The victims included driver Rahim, Haris and Hashim. Two bodies have been recovered.

In the third incident, a man from Lahore, Fazal Mehmood, fell unconscious after taking adulterated syrup in the Charbagh area.

He was taken to a hospital where he died. Police have registered a case.

In Kokari village, an elderly doctor was kicked by a donkey in abdomen. He died on the spot.
